PurposeThyroid associated ophthalmopathy(TAO) is the most common autoimmune orbital disease in adult, mainly involving the orbital fat and extraocular muscle, and most patients with TAO have foreign body sensation, dryness, photophobia, fear of wind, tears, etc. The literatures showed that autoimmune disease is a risk factor for dry eyes, and the epidemiological study showed that the prevalence of dry eye in patients with TAO is 45% ~ 85%. The mechanisms of dry eye in patients with TAO is that eyelid retreat, exophthalmos and palpebral fissure broadening lead to ocular surface evaporation and high tear osmotic pressure, causing dry eyes in previous studies. In recent years, some research suggested that the inflammation of TAO is a major cause of dry eyes occurred.TAO patients may have the difference of the incidence, tear and cornea in different clinical stages, but now such research is less. So 281 patients with TAO were divided into groups in this study. We observe that the incidence of dry eye in patients with TAO, the incidence of dry eye in inflammatory active period and inactive period, and the incidence of dry eye short, medium, long three course group.According to the CAS score, they were divided into two groups observation to clinical staging, activity of and course group, observe the incidence of this group of patients with TAO overall dry eyes and dry eye examination result, TAO inflammatory activity and the activity the incidence of dry eyes, TAO short, medium, long three course group, the prevalence of dry eye. And we analyze the characteristics of dry eyes in different periods in order to provide an objective basis for the change of the tear film and cornea and look for the right solution in different clinical stages of inflammatory activity. Materials and Methods 1 Research objects and groupingA total of 281 TAO patients whose date were collected in our hospital from January to December in 2014. Including 114 males and 167 females, patients age from 9years old to 69 years old, the average age is(43.2±0.8) years old, of which 2 weeks to 14 years is the course of TAO. Limiting factors :(1) according to the diagnostic criteria of Bartley;(2) without anti-inflammatory drugs and artificial tears;(3) complete ophthalmic testing. Exclusion criteria:(1) autommune diseases;(2) other eye dieases;(3) wearing corneal contact lens;(4) patients with pregnancy or lactation;(5) work environment with strong light or chemical volatiles. According to the CAS score, they were divided into two groups as TAO active period(CAS≥4 points, 96cases) and TAO inactive period group(CAS < 4points, 185cases). According to the course of the disease, they were divided into three groups as short(course <1a, 180 cases)、 middle(course 1~2a, 46 cases) and long course(course>2a, 55 cases).This research program was approved by the Institutional Review Board of Zhengzhou University. All of the patients had signed informed consent. 2 MethodsObserve and record the age, gender, duration of TAO, dry eye symptoms of patients, then Schirmer I test(SIt), break- up time(BUT) and cornea fluorescent staining(FS). SIt evaluation standard: record the wet length of paper; BUT evaluation criteria: the break-up time of tear film measured three times; FS evaluation criteria: the cornea is divided into four quadrants, and each quadrant score is 0 to 3 points. 3 Statistical analysisUsing SAS 9.1 statistical software to analyze all the data. The levels of course, SIt, BUT and FS were expressed in the form of the x±s. The incidence of comparison between groups used c2 test; Each group of data carried on the test of normality and the homogeneity of variance, then used rank sum test. The significance level was P < 0.05. Results 1 The incidence of dry eye in patients with TAOThe incidence of dry eye is 65.48% in 281 patients.The course of 184 patients range 2 months to 7 years, the average months(14.3 + 1.0). 2 The incidence of active period and inactive period in patients with TAOThe incidence of TAO active period and TAO inactive period were 77.08% and 59.46%, and two period had statistical significance(c2=8.685,P=0.003). 3 The incidence of short, medium and long duration group in patients with TAOThe incidence of short, medium and long course were 68.89%, 69.57% and 50.91%. Short course and long course had statistical significance(c2=5.961,P =0.015). 4 The tests of patients with TAOThere were 281 cases(562 eyes) in this study. There were 154 eyes(27.40%) with 5 mm/min under, 168 eyes(29.89%) with 5 mm/min / 5 ~ 10 mm min and 240 eyes(42.70%) with more than 10 mm / 5 min. There were 297 eyes(52.85%) with under 5 s, 221 eyes(39.32%) with 5 s ~ 10 s and 44 eyes(7.83%) with more than 10 s. There were 365 eyes(64.95%) with 0 point, 142 eyes(25.27%) with 1 ~ 3 point and 55 eyes(9.79%) with more than 3 point. 5 The characteristics of active period and inactive period in patients with TAOThe SIt of active period(12.65±7.79) mm / 5 min is higher than inactive period(11.93±9.87) mm / 5 min(P < 0.05). The BUT of active period(4.81±2.43) s is shorter than inactive period(6.07±3.05) s(P < 0.05). The FS of active period(1.16±2.01) is higher than inactive period(0.80±1.80)(P < 0.05). 6 The characteristics of short, medium and long course group in patients with TAOThe SIt of short, medium and long course group are(12.70 + 8.83) mm / 5 min,(10.75-8.70) mm / 5 min and(13.84 + 10.02) mm / 5 min, and there was no statistically significant difference(H=5.716,P=0.057). The BUT of short, medium and long course group are(5.51-2.95) s,(5.31-2.23) s,(6.22-3.15) s, and there was no statistically significant difference(H=4.636,P=0.099). The FS of short, medium and long course group are(1.13 + 2.09),(0.62-1.73),(0.50-1.19), and the difference has statistically significance(H=18.184,P=0.0001). ConclusionsThe incidence of dry eye in TAO patients is higher than normal person. The vast majority of patients with TAO appear unstable in tear film, more than half of patients with TAO is inadequate in tear secretion, and about a one of third patients with TAO is damaged in corneal epithelium. There were different in TAO active、inactive period and different course. Inflammation is a key factor in the pathogenesis of dry eye with TAO.The incidence of dry eye reduced in the patients with course>2a, and the stability of tear film is still lower than normal level.
